Skip to content

Commit

Permalink
Merge f55d445 into 238f18e
Browse files Browse the repository at this point in the history
  • Loading branch information
codealchemy committed Aug 9, 2021
2 parents 238f18e + f55d445 commit bb923f0
Show file tree
Hide file tree
Showing 5 changed files with 8 additions and 7 deletions.
3 changes: 2 additions & 1 deletion Gemfile
Expand Up @@ -22,7 +22,8 @@ end
group :test do
gem 'cancancan', '~> 3.0'
gem 'carrierwave', ['>= 2.0.0.rc', '< 3']
gem 'database_cleaner', ['>= 1.2', '!= 1.4.0', '!= 1.5.0', '< 2.0']
gem 'database_cleaner-mongoid', '>= 2.0', require: false
gem 'database_cleaner-active_record', '>= 2.0', require: false
gem 'dragonfly', '~> 1.0'
gem 'factory_bot', '>= 4.2'
gem 'generator_spec', '>= 0.8'
Expand Down
3 changes: 2 additions & 1 deletion gemfiles/rails_6.0.gemfile
Expand Up @@ -32,7 +32,8 @@ end
group :test do
gem "cancancan", "~> 3.0"
gem "carrierwave", [">= 2.0.0.rc", "< 3"]
gem "database_cleaner", [">= 1.2", "!= 1.4.0", "!= 1.5.0", "< 2.0"]
gem "database_cleaner-mongoid", ">= 2.0", require: false
gem "database_cleaner-active_record", ">= 2.0", require: false
gem "dragonfly", "~> 1.0"
gem "factory_bot", ">= 4.2"
gem "generator_spec", ">= 0.8"
Expand Down
3 changes: 2 additions & 1 deletion gemfiles/rails_6.1.gemfile
Expand Up @@ -32,7 +32,8 @@ end
group :test do
gem "cancancan", "~> 3.2"
gem "carrierwave", [">= 2.0.0.rc", "< 3"]
gem "database_cleaner", [">= 1.2", "!= 1.4.0", "!= 1.5.0", "< 2.0"]
gem "database_cleaner-mongoid", ">= 2.0", require: false
gem "database_cleaner-active_record", ">= 2.0", require: false
gem "dragonfly", "~> 1.0"
gem "factory_bot", ">= 4.2"
gem "generator_spec", ">= 0.8"
Expand Down
2 changes: 0 additions & 2 deletions spec/orm/active_record.rb
@@ -1,7 +1,5 @@
require 'rails_admin/adapters/active_record'

DatabaseCleaner.strategy = :transaction

ActiveRecord::Base.connection.data_sources.each do |table|
ActiveRecord::Base.connection.drop_table(table)
end
Expand Down
4 changes: 2 additions & 2 deletions spec/spec_helper.rb
Expand Up @@ -32,7 +32,7 @@
require 'factory_bot'
require 'factories'
require 'policies'
require 'database_cleaner'
require "database_cleaner/#{CI_ORM}"
require "orm/#{CI_ORM}"

Dir[File.expand_path('../support/**/*.rb', __FILE__),
Expand Down Expand Up @@ -93,7 +93,7 @@ def password_digest(password)
end

config.before do |example|
DatabaseCleaner.strategy = (CI_ORM == :mongoid || example.metadata[:js]) ? :truncation : :transaction
DatabaseCleaner.strategy = (CI_ORM == :mongoid || example.metadata[:js]) ? :deletion : :transaction

DatabaseCleaner.start
RailsAdmin::Config.reset
Expand Down

0 comments on commit bb923f0

Please sign in to comment.